html {
	height:100%
}
body {
	height:100%;
	padding:0;
	margin:0;
	background:url('/img/top-bg.gif') repeat-x 0px 10px;
	text-align:left;
	font:11px Arial, Tahoma, sans-serif;
	color:#333333
}
DIV.border-top {
	width:100%;
	border-top:6px solid #000000
}
FORM { margin:0; padding:0 }
.brd1 { border:#ccc 1px solid }
.red { color:#df2026 }
.logo { margin-left:15px; margin-top:3px }
.tsn { margin-right:15px; margin-top:2px }
.bold { font-weight:bold }
.f9 { font-size:9px }
.f10 { font-size:10px }
.c6 { color:#666666 }
.c9 { color:#999999 }
.cb { color:#bbbbbb }
.tech_pad { border:#ccc 1px solid; margin:7px 10px 7px 0 }
INPUT { margin:0; border:0; padding:0 }
.div_text { font-size:11px; width:110px; height:16px; padding-top:2px; border:0; background:url('/img/find.png') top left no-repeat }
.input_text { font-size:11px; width:102px; height:18px; border:0; background:transparent }
.div_300 { width:300px; height:16px; padding-top:2px; border:0; background:url('/img/btn_300.png') top left no-repeat }
.input_300 { font-size:11px; width:292px; height:18px; border:0; background:transparent }
.div_100 { font-size:11px; width:300px; height:100px; border:0; background:url('/img/text_100.png') top left no-repeat }
.text_100 { font-size:11px; width:292px; height:97px; border:0; background:transparent }
.btn_110 { font-size:11px; width:110px; height:18px; padding-bottom:1px; border:0; background:url('/img/find.png') top left no-repeat }
.count { width:24px; height:16px; border:0; padding-top:2px; background:url('/img/count.png') top left no-repeat; text-align:center }
.input_center { text-align:center }
.btn { font-size:11px; width:70px; height:18px; padding-bottom:1px; border:0; background:url('/img/find_btn.png') top left no-repeat; text-align:center }
.tbl_top { background:url('/img/box-heading.gif') repeat-x left bottom }
.select { font-size:11px; width:110px; height:18px; border:1px solid #cccccc }
.select150 { font-size:11px; width:150px; height:18px; border:1px solid #cccccc }
.select200 { font-size:11px; width:200px; height:18px; border:1px solid #cccccc }
TR.brd_up TD { border-top:1px solid #e5e5e5 }
TR.passive TD { color:#999999 }
TR.bold TD { font-weight:bold }
.ptop { padding-top:4px }
.ptop8 { padding-top:8px }
DIV.ya_probki { width:88px; height:110px; position:absolute; z-index:9; margin: -110px 0 0 402px }
DIV.banner_top { position:absolute; z-index:9; margin:6px 0 0 -74px; width:660px; height:46px }
IMG.sale { position:absolute; z-index:9; margin:-5px 0 0 -150px }

a:link, a:visited { font-size:11px; color:#1855b7; text-decoration:underline }
a:hover { font-size:11px; color:#3970bb; text-decoration:none }

a.link_h1:link, a.link_h1:visited { font-size:18px; color:#1855b7; text-decoration:underline }
a.link_h1:hover { font-size:18px; color:#3970bb; text-decoration:none }

.menu_top {
	list-style:none none;
	margin:0;
	padding:0;
	float:left
}
.menu_top a, .menu_top a:visited, .menu_top div.inmenu {
	width:auto;
	display:block;
	padding:5px 22px 5px 9px;
	font-size:11px;
	text-decoration:none;
	background:url('/img/str.gif') no-repeat 0px 9px;
}
.menu_top a, .menu_top a:visited {
	color:#666666;
}
.menu_top a:hover, .menu_top a.menu_on, .menu_top a:visited.menu_on, .menu_top div.inmenu {
	color:#999999;
	background:url('/img/str_on.gif') no-repeat 0px 9px;
}
.menu_top a.mn_sell, .menu_top a.mn_sell:visited, .menu_top a.mn_sell:hover {
	color:#999999;
	background:url('/img/str_on.gif') no-repeat 0px 9px;
}



UL.menu {
	list-style:none none;
	padding:0px;
	margin:0;
}
.menu_li {
	margin:0;
	padding:0;
}
.menu_li a, .menu_li a:visited {
	width:auto;
	display:block;
	padding:5px 23px 5px 26px;
	font-size:11px;
	text-decoration:none;
	background: url('/img/str_on.gif') no-repeat 18px 9px;
	color:#666666;
}
.menu_li a:hover, .menu_li a.menu_on, .menu_li a:visited.menu_on, .menu_li a.mn_sell, .menu_li a.mn_sell:visited, .menu_li a.mn_sell:hover {
	background: url('/img/str_on.gif') no-repeat 18px 9px;
	color:#999999;
	font-size:11px;
	background-color:#111111
}



.left_side {
	clear:both
}
.left_side .block {
	clear:both; border:#ccc 1px solid; margin-bottom:15px
}
.left_side .block H6 {
	font-weight: bold; font-size:11px; color:#000000; line-height: 11px; text-decoration: none
}
.left_side .block H6 {
	padding:3px 5px; background:url('/img/box-heading.gif') repeat-x left bottom; margin:0
}
.left_side .block UL {
	margin: 1px; list-style-type: none
}
.left_side .block UL LI {
	display: block; background:url('/img/str.gif') no-repeat 0px 4px; padding-left: 9px; margin-bottom: 3px
}
.left_side .block UL LI A {
	color:#666666; text-decoration: none
}
.left_side .block UL LI A:hover {
	color:#999999
}
.left_side .block UL LI UL LI A:hover {
	color:#999999
}
.left_side .block .box {
	padding-right: 15px; padding-left: 15px; background: url('/img/sidebar-bg.gif') repeat-y left top; padding-bottom: 14px; margin: 1px; border-top-style: none; padding-top: 14px; border-right-style: none; border-left-style: none; list-style-type: none; border-bottom-style: none
}



.right_side {
	clear:both; display:block; overflow:auto; position:static
}
.right_side .block {
	clear:both; border:#ccc 1px solid; margin-bottom:15px
}
.right_side .block H6 {
	font-weight: bold; font-size:11px; color: #000000; line-height:11px; text-decoration:none
}
.right_side .block H6 A {
	font-weight: bold; font-size:11px; color: #000000; line-height:11px; text-decoration:none
}
.right_side .block H6 {
	padding:3px 5px; background:url('/img/box-heading.gif') repeat-x left bottom; margin:0
}
.right_side .block UL {
	margin:0; padding:0; list-style-type:none
}
.right_side .block UL LI {
	display: block; background:url('/img/str.gif') no-repeat 0px 4px; padding-left:11px; margin-bottom:3px
}
.right_side .block UL LI A, .right_side .block UL LI A:visited {
	color:#666666; text-decoration:none
}
.right_side .block UL LI A:hover {
	color:#999999
}
.right_side .block UL LI UL LI A:hover {
	color:#999999
}
.right_side .block .box {
	padding-right: 15px; padding-left: 15px; background: url('/img/targetblock.gif') repeat-y left top; padding-bottom: 14px; margin: 1px; border-top-style: none; padding-top: 14px; border-right-style: none; border-left-style: none; list-style-type: none; border-bottom-style: none
}






.content {
	WIDTH: 490px
}
.content .visual {
	display: block; margin-bottom: 10px; position: relative
}
.content .border {
	background: url('/img/content-border.gif') repeat-x left bottom; margin-bottom: 15px; border-top-style: none; line-height: 1px; border-right-style: none; border-left-style: none; height: 1px; border-bottom-style: none
}
.content .border HR {
	display: none
}
.content .heading {
	padding-right: 9px; padding-left: 9px; background: url('/img/content-heading.gif') repeat-x left top; padding-bottom: 15px; padding-top: 15px
}
.content .heading H1 {
	font-WEIGHT: bold; font-SIZE: 16px; color: #000; text-decoration: none
}
.content .heading H1 A {
	font-WEIGHT: bold; font-SIZE: 16px; color: #000
}
.content .heading H2 {
	margin-top: 8px
}
.content .heading H2 {
	font-WEIGHT: bold; font-SIZE: 12px; color: #333333
}
.content .heading H2 A {
	font-WEIGHT: bold; font-SIZE: 12px; color: #333333
}
.content H4 {
	margin-bottom: 11px
}
.content H4 {
	font-WEIGHT: bold; font-SIZE: 11px; color: #112e83
}
.content H4 A {
	font-WEIGHT: bold; font-SIZE: 11px; color: #112e83
}
.content P {
	font-SIZE: 11px; margin-bottom: 15px; color: #333; line-height: 14px; text-align: justify
}
.content DIV.paragraph {
	font-SIZE: 11px; margin-bottom: 15px; color: #333; line-height: 14px; text-align: justify
}
.content DIV.paragraph IMG {
	margin-right: 10px
}
.content UL {
	padding-right: 0px; padding-left: 0px; padding-bottom: 0px; margin: 0px 0px 20px; padding-top: 0px; list-style-type: none
}
.content UL LI {
	padding-left: 14px; background: url('/img/list-bullet.gif') no-repeat 0px 6px; color: #000; line-height: 16px
}
.content UL LI A {
	display: inline; color: #000; line-height: 16px
}
.content UL LI A:hover {
	color: #112e83
}
